RE: Fletching colors ?
i use all white fletchings, and a white ez-crest wrap with a fl orange nock. They work well for me, they are very easy to see in flight and make it very easy to spot blood.

RE: Fletching colors ?
Hey Jerry,
How is that EZ-Fletch to use? I've been thinking of personalizing my arrows with it too, but don't know anybody who's tried it. Does it go on 'EZ' ? Is it thin enough to be low profile against the shaft, or does it create a bump where it starts? |
RE: Fletching colors ?
It goes on fairly easy just be real careful putting it on, i've messed up a couple and ened up with some bumps. The bumps don't seem to effect your accruarcy that much but if i mess one up i only use it to pratice. Save the perfect ones for the hunting quiver.
